Château Haut-Brion--Vintage 1945
Pessac (Graves), 1er cru classé. Château-bottled
Slightly corroded capsules
Slightly bin-soiled labels. Levels: upper shoulder
Tasting note: Another great wine. Consistently fine. One of Haut Brion's best ever vintages. It seems to have regained depth of colour with age, again almost opaque but with mature amber rim. On nose and palate, it is different from its Medoc peers. More earthy, but not in a clodhopping way, and with a tobacco-like element to its taste. The bouquet variously described as gently and fragrant, sweet, vanilla and chocolate, warm, spicey, complete-and always remarkably good. Prettty full-bodied yet velvety, with loads of sweetening and enriching alcohol, its tannin masked by richness and extract. Great length, wonderful aftertaste. M.B.
